Description:
• Execute data pull requests for new business development leads
• Identify & reconcile any claims needed for monthly client invoice processes
• Generate supporting details to guide internal Medication Access Services (MAS) & Payor Access (PAS) Services efforts for client targeting/prioritization and budgeting/forecasting of client performance
• Analyze client specific details to support strategic discussions with MAS & PAS accounts
• Support product & operations by pulling background details needed to understand data quality issues or help guide advancement of internal processes
• Attend routine meetings to update project status and communicate any potential barriers or delays
• Identify process improvement opportunities
• Perform other duties as assigned
Requirements:
• Skills in Microsoft Excel, PowerPoint, and Word
• Experience working in a health system specialty pharmacy
• Experience managing the implementation, optimization, utilization, and maintenance of large data sets
• 2-3 years experience or equivalent in specialty pharmacy; health system specialty preferred
• Ability to write and edit code in Python/Pyspark.
• Knowledge of pharmacy economics & reimbursement
• Familiar with common specialty products or ability to identify a specialty product
• Familiar with pharmacy payors and access requirements
